Washing Machine Overflow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ill | Yes | No | You can clean up the spill yourself with a towel and some elbow grease. |
| Large water spill | No | Yes | A large water spill needs specialized equipment and expertise to clean up properly. |
| Water damage to walls or ceilings | No | Yes | Water damage to walls or ceilings needs a professional assessment and cleanup to prevent further damage. |
| Musty odors or mold growth | No | Yes | Musty odors and mold growth need a professional assessment and cleanup to prevent further damage. |

Washing Machine Overflow Water Removal Cost in Southern Trails, TX
The cost of washing machine overflow water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Southern Trails, TX. Our estimates are based on a thorough assessment of the damage. Our team will work with you to find out the best course of action and provide a customized estimate for your job.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the amount of time required to dry the area. |
| Cleaning and disinfection |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ning products used. |
| Restoration and repairs |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ials required for repairs. |

Q: What causes a washing machine to overflow?
A: A washing machine can overflow due to a clogged drain hose, a faulty water inlet valve, or a malfunctioning drain pump. We’ll work with you to find out the cause of the overflow. Our team will assess the situation and provide a customized solution to prevent further damage.

Q: How can I prevent washing machine overflows?
A: You can prevent washing machine overflows by regularly inspecting your washing machine’s hoses and connections, checking the drain hose for kinks or blockages, and running a cleaning cycle regularly.
